Quick And Creamy Swedish Meatball Soup: Easy Pressure Cooker Delight

Enjoy a quick and delicious creamy Swedish meatball soup made effortlessly in your pressure cooker.

-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 10 minutes
- Total Time: 25 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ings

- 1 pound ground beef
- 1/2 cup breadcrumbs
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 4 cups beef broth
- 2 cups heavy cream
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1 cup frozen peas
- In a bowl, mix ground beef, breadcrumbs, Parmesan, onion powder,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per.
- Form the mixture into small meatballs.
- Set the pressure cooker to sauté mode and brown the meatballs on all sides.
- Add beef broth, cream, and Worcestershire sauce to the pot.
- Seal the lid and cook on high pressure for 10 minutes.
- Use quick release to release pressure, then stir in frozen peas.
Notes
- This soup is best served warm and can be garnished with fresh parsley.
- Feel free to adjust the seasoning according to your taste.
